    The Somerset County Courthouse is located in Somerville, the county seat Somerset County, in the U.S. state of New Jersey . Constructed in between 1907 and 1909 in the Neo-classical style Palladian style and is faced with Sylacauga marble. It had once been considered for demolition for not being large enough to accommodate the growing county.

    Designated NJRHP. September 29, 1994. The Union County Courthouse is the county courthouse for Union County, New Jersey located in the county seat of Elizabeth. [7] The 17 story, 238 ft (73 m) tall Neoclassical building, completed in 1931, is the tallest in the city. [1] [8] It is a contributing property to the Mid-Town Historic District. [6]

    The Cape May County Courthouse is located at 9 North Main Street in Cape May Court House, the county seat of Cape May County, which itself is in Middle Township, New Jersey, United States. [1] It was designed by Edwards & Green of Camden and Philadelphia [2] and built in 1926–1927 by Bennett McLaughlin Company, also of Philadelphia.
